1. Submitting a Takedown Notice

Your DMCA notice must include all of the following:
  • A description of the copyrighted work you claim has been infringed.
  • A description of the material you claim is infringing and its location on Musóna (URL or specific description).
  • Your contact information: name, mailing address, phone number, and email address.
  • A statement that you have a good-faith belief that the use of the material is not authorized by the copyright owner, its agent, or the law.
  • A statement, under penalty of perjury, that the information in your notice is accurate and that you are the copyright owner or authorized to act on the owner's behalf.
  • Your physical or electronic signature.

4. Counter-Notices

If you believe your content was removed in error, you may submit a counter-notice to the address above. Counter-notices must include: identification of the removed material and its prior location; a statement under penalty of perjury that removal was a mistake or misidentification; your contact information; and your physical or electronic signature. We will forward valid counter-notices to the original complainant.
